The Mind-Gut Immunity Method: A Personalized Approach

At the heart of Dr. Dasari’s method is the belief that healing lupus begins in the gut. His Mind-Gut Immunity (MGI) Method integrates:

  • Custom meal plans based on microbiome testing

  • Phytonutrient-focused food combinations

  • Probiotic recalibration protocols

  • Gradual reintroduction of flexible “cheat” meals after gut repair

Patients often see dramatic improvements within 6 weeks, reporting less fatigue, reduced swelling, and stabilized immune markers.

This approach doesn’t reject veganism — it optimizes it with science-based principles.


Scientific Studies Supporting Diet and Lupus Improvement

Several studies reinforce Dr. Dasari’s findings:

  • Plant-Based Diets and Lupus Symptoms (2022) – Found 26% reduction in symptom severity with plant-based diets.
    Source: Clinical Nutrition Open Science, 2022.

  • Raw Vegan Diet Case Study (2024) – Three patients achieved sustained remission for 6+ years post-diet adoption.
    Source: Frontiers in Immunology, 2024.

  • Curcumin in Lupus (2019) – Curcumin, a polyphenol in turmeric, was shown to reduce inflammatory activity in lupus patients.
    Source: Journal of Cellular Biochemistry, 2019.

  • Gut Microbiota and Autoimmune Modulation (2022) – Highlighted probiotics’ role in regulating immune overactivation in SLE.
    Source: Frontiers in Immunology, 2022.


Conclusion: What’s Truly the Best Diet for Lupus?

The best diet for lupus isn’t about strict labels like “vegan” or “keto.” It’s about restoring immune balance through gut health.

Dr. Chanu Dasari’s research and clinical experience show that the winning formula is a phytonutrient-rich, microbiome-supportive diet tailored to your sensitivities.

Whole, colorful plants — not processed “vegan” substitutes — are your allies. Combine them with plant-based omega oils, controlled protein intake, and probiotic support, and you can help your body calm the inflammatory chaos of lupus.


What You Should Do

  • Focus on whole, unprocessed foods: vegetables, fruits, seeds, herbs, and legumes

  • Incorporate anti-inflammatory phytonutrients like turmeric, ginger, and berries

  • Support your gut microbiome with fermented foods or quality probiotics

  • Maintain adequate protein and omega-3 fats from plant sources

  • Consider food sensitivity testing to customize your diet

What You Should Avoid

  • Processed vegan foods (fake meats, soy isolates, vegan cheese)

  • Refined sugars, white flour, and artificial sweeteners

  • Animal fats and high-cholesterol meat products

  • Excess gluten, additives, or alcohol

  • Skipping meals or extreme calorie restriction
